Zum Hauptinhalt springen

Wie viele Bits werden benötigt, um 32 eindeutige Codes zu generieren

Wenn es um die Datenübertragung geht, ist es ein wichtiger Aspekt, die richtige Anzahl von Bits auszuwählen, um die Informationen zu codieren. In der realen Welt müssen wir uns oft mit verschiedenen Codes befassen, sei es mit Buchstaben des Alphabets, Zahlen, Symbolen oder anderen Elementen.

Eine der am häufigsten gestellten Fragen ist, wie viele Bits benötigt werden, um 32 verschiedene Codes darzustellen. Um diese Frage zu beantworten, müssen Sie die Grundlagen der Bitdarstellung von Informationen verstehen.

In der Informatik Bit (aus dem Englischen. bit - binary digit) ist eine Informationseinheit. Zwei mögliche Zustände können mit einem Bit codiert werden: 0 oder 1. So kann 1 Bit zwei verschiedene Kombinationen darstellen. Es wird eine bestimmte Anzahl von Bits benötigt, um 32 verschiedene Codes darzustellen.

Allgemeine Informationen zu Bits und Codierungen

Kodierung - der Prozess der Darstellung von Informationen in Form einer Folge von Bits. Es ermöglicht Ihnen, Daten mit elektronischen Geräten zu speichern, zu übertragen und zu verarbeiten.

Bei der Datencodierung werden verschiedene Systeme verwendet, z. B. ein binäres Zahlensystem. Das Binärsystem basiert auf der Verwendung von nur zwei Ziffern - 0 und 1. Es wird häufig in Computern und anderen elektronischen Geräten zur Darstellung und Verarbeitung von Informationen verwendet.

Codes werden verwendet, um verschiedene Zeichen, Zahlen und andere Daten darzustellen. Codes stellen Zeichen oder Zahlen als Folge von Bits dar.

Die Anzahl der Bits, die benötigt werden, um eine bestimmte Anzahl von Codes darzustellen, hängt von der Anzahl der möglichen Werte ab, die dargestellt werden können. Zum Beispiel benötigen Sie mindestens 5 Bits, um 32 verschiedene Codes darzustellen, da 2 im fünften Grad 32 ist.

Kodieren von Informationen in Bytes

Sie müssen eine bestimmte Anzahl von Bits verwenden, um 32 verschiedene Codes zu codieren. Zuerst finden wir die nächste Zahl, die als Grad der Zweiheit dargestellt werden kann, und wird der Grad der Zahl sein 2 (2, 4, 8, 16, 32 ) größer oder gleich 32. In diesem Fall sind es 64.

Daher werden mindestens 6 Bits benötigt, um 32 verschiedene Codes zu codieren. Die verbleibenden 2 Bits sind unbenutzt.

Um also 32 verschiedene Codes zu codieren, benötigen Sie 6 Bits, und die restlichen 2 Bits sind überflüssig.

Anwendungsbeispiele:

- Die Zeichencodes in Computern (ASCII) werden als 8-Bit-Sequenzen dargestellt, wodurch 256 verschiedene Zeichen codiert werden können.

- Für ganzzahlige Variablen, die 32 Bits (4 Bytes) im Speicher belegen, kann man sich eine Zahl zwischen -2^31 und 2^31-1 vorstellen, was etwa 4,2 Milliarden verschiedene Werte entspricht.

- Bei der Arbeit mit digitalen Bildern kann jedes Pixel mit verschiedenen Kodierungen dargestellt werden, z. B. 8-Bit (256 Farben), 24-Bit (16,7 Millionen Farben) usw.

Es ist wichtig sich daran zu erinnern, dass die Anzahl der Codes, die mit einer bestimmten Anzahl von Bits dargestellt werden können, exponentiell zunimmt. Daher müssen Sie bei der Auswahl der Codierungsgröße die Anforderungen an die Anzahl der möglichen Codes und die Menge an Speicher berücksichtigen, die zum Speichern dieser Codes erforderlich ist.

Was ist ein Byte und wie funktioniert es?

Bytes dienen zur Darstellung und Speicherung von Informationen, Kombinationen davon können verwendet werden, um Zeichen, Zahlen, Töne und Bilder zu codieren. Bytes können zu größeren Daten wie Wörtern, doppelten Wörtern, Datenblöcken usw. kombiniert werden.

Computer arbeiten mit Daten in Bytes, indem sie verschiedene Vorgänge wie Lesen, Schreiben, Verarbeiten und Übertragen von Daten ausführen. Bytes können von externen Geräten gelesen, in den Speicher geschrieben, vom Zentralprozessor verarbeitet und über das Netzwerk übertragen werden.

In digitalen Systemen können Bytes als Sequenzen von Bits behandelt werden, wobei jedes Bit einen bestimmten Wert oder einen bestimmten Zustand darstellt. Bits können verwendet werden, um Binärzahlen, Flags, Zustände oder andere Informationen darzustellen.

Die Verwendung von Bytes in digitaler Technologie ermöglicht die effiziente Speicherung und Übertragung von Informationen sowie die Verarbeitung und Verwendung in verschiedenen Systemen und Anwendungen.

Anwenden der Byte-Codierung

Die Byte-Codierung ist die Grundlage für die elektronische Darstellung von Daten, bei der Informationen in eine Folge von Bytes aufgeteilt werden. Jedes Byte besteht aus 8 Bits, so dass verschiedene Werte codiert und übertragen werden können.

In Computernetzen ermöglicht die Byte-Codierung die Übertragung von Daten zwischen Computern und Geräten, bei denen die Informationen als Bytes dargestellt werden. Auf diese Weise können Sie Dateien, Bilder, Videos und Audios austauschen und andere Operationen im Zusammenhang mit der Übertragung von Informationen durchführen.

Die Byte-Codierung wird auch häufig in der digitalen Datenspeicherung verwendet. Es ermöglicht Ihnen, Informationen kompakt darzustellen und zu speichern, wodurch die Dateigröße reduziert wird. Dies ist besonders wichtig, wenn große Datenmengen wie Datenbanken oder Archive gespeichert werden.

Außerdem wird die Byte-Codierung in verschiedenen Multimedia-Formaten wie Video (z. B. MPEG), Audio (z. B. MP3) und Bildern (z. B. JPEG) verwendet. Es ermöglicht eine effiziente Übertragung und Komprimierung von Daten, während die Qualität und Genauigkeit der Daten beibehalten werden.

Die Byte-Codierung ist daher ein wesentlicher Bestandteil moderner Technologien und Anwendungen, sodass Daten in verschiedenen Bereichen effizient gespeichert, übertragen und verarbeitet werden können.

Kodieren von Informationen in Bits

Um 32 verschiedene Codes zu codieren, muss eine minimale Anzahl von Bits verwendet werden, um eine ausreichende Anzahl von Kombinationen zu gewährleisten. In diesem Fall ist es ausreichend, 5 Bits (2^ 5 = 32) zu verwenden, um 32 verschiedene Codes zu codieren.

Jedem dieser 32 Codes kann eine eindeutige Kombination von 5 Bits zugewiesen werden: 00000, 00001, 00010, und so weiter, zu 11111. Mit dieser Codierung können wir 32 verschiedene Informationsvarianten in einer Sequenz von 5 Bits darstellen.

Die Kodierung von Informationen in Bits ist wichtig für die Übertragung von Daten über große Entfernungen, die Speicherung von Informationen auf elektronischen Geräten und die Verarbeitung von Informationen in Computern. Durch die Möglichkeit, verschiedene Zeichen, Zahlen und andere Daten in Bitform darzustellen, können wir Informationen austauschen, digitale Geräte verwenden und effizient und zuverlässig mit Daten arbeiten.

Wie viele Bits benötigen Sie, um 32 verschiedene Werte zu codieren?

Die Anzahl der Bits, die zum Codieren von 32 verschiedenen Werten benötigt werden, kann mithilfe einer Formel gefunden werden, die auf einem binären Zahlensystem basiert. Die Essenz der Formel besteht darin, dass die Anzahl der Bits dem Logarithmus der Anzahl möglicher Werte auf Basis 2 entspricht.

In diesem Fall gibt es 32 verschiedene Werte, dh 2 ist im fünften Grad (2^5) gleich 32. Daher sind 5 Bits erforderlich, um 32 verschiedene Werte zu codieren.

BedeutungBitdarstellung
000000
100001
200010
300011
400100
500101
600110
700111
801000
901001
1001010
1101011
1201100
1301101
1401110
1501111
1610000
1710001
1810010
1910011
2010100
2110101
2210110
2310111
2411000
2511001
2611010
2711011
2811100
2911101
3011110
3111111

Merkmale der Verwendung von Bitcodierung

Ein Merkmal der Verwendung von Bitcodierung ist seine Kompaktheit. Ein einzelnes Bit kann zwei mögliche Werte darstellen, wodurch eine große Menge an Informationen mit minimalem Speicheraufwand codiert werden kann.

Die Bitcodierung hat auch eine hohe Übertragungseffizienz. Durch die Verwendung von zwei möglichen Werten für jedes Bit werden die Übertragung und Interpretation von Informationen zuverlässiger und schneller.

Die Verwendung der Bitcodierung kann jedoch schwierig sein, da die Informationen korrekt in Bits aufgeteilt und anschließend interpretiert werden müssen. Falsche Codierung oder Decodierung kann zu Fehlern und Datenverlust führen.

Der große Vorteil der Bitcodierung liegt in ihrer Vielseitigkeit. Es kann in verschiedenen Bereichen wie Computernetzwerken, Audio- und Videokomprimierung, Datenverschlüsselung usw. angewendet werden.

Wenn Sie sich der Besonderheiten der Verwendung von Bitcodierung bewusst sind, können Sie sie effektiv für verschiedene Aufgaben verwenden, um die Übertragung und Speicherung von Informationen zu vereinfachen und ihre Sicherheit und Zuverlässigkeit zu gewährleisten.

Bitcode bei der Übertragung von Daten über das Netzwerk

Um Daten über das Netzwerk zu übertragen, wird ein Bitcode verwendet, der Informationen in Form einer Bitfolge darstellt. Jedes Bit kann zwei mögliche Werte haben: 0 oder 1. Die Anzahl der Bits, die für die Datenübertragung benötigt werden, hängt von der Menge an Informationen ab, die wir übertragen möchten.

Es gibt ein binäres Zahlensystem, bei dem Zahlen als eine Folge von Bits dargestellt werden. Zum Beispiel benötigen wir 5 Bits, um 32 verschiedene Codes zu übertragen, da 2 in der Potenz von 5 32 ist. Das heißt, jedes dieser 5 Bits kann zwei mögliche Werte haben: 0 oder 1.

Wenn Daten über ein Netzwerk übertragen werden, wird jedes Zeichen oder jede Zahl als eine Folge von Bits dargestellt. Um beispielsweise ein Zeichen 'A' darzustellen, muss eine Bitfolge verwendet werden, die diesem Zeichen entspricht.

Es ist wichtig zu beachten, dass die Übertragungsgeschwindigkeit im Netzwerk von der Anzahl der Bits abhängt, die übertragen werden müssen. Je mehr Bits vorhanden sind, desto langsamer wird die Datenübertragung. Daher ist die Optimierung der Datenübertragung über das Netzwerk ein wichtiger Aspekt bei der Entwicklung von Netzwerkanwendungen.

Die Rolle des Bitcodes bei der Übertragung von Daten über das Netzwerk

Der Bitcode ermöglicht es Computern und Geräten, diese Werte zu unterscheiden und zu interpretieren, um Informationen zu senden und zu empfangen. Jedes Bit kann als einer von zwei Zuständen dargestellt werden: ein oder aus.

Bei der Übertragung von Daten über das Netzwerk werden verschiedene Codierungsmethoden verwendet, die Informationen in Bitcode umwandeln. Zum Beispiel kann ein ASCII-Code verwendet werden, um Textinformationen zu senden, wobei jedes Zeichen durch eine bestimmte Bitfolge dargestellt wird. Andere Codierungsmethoden, wie binäre Codierung oder Huffman-Codierung, ermöglichen es auch, Daten effizient als Bits für die Übertragung über das Netzwerk darzustellen.

Durch den Bitcode können Informationen ohne Änderungen oder Verluste über das Netzwerk übertragen werden, vorausgesetzt, die Datenverbindung ist zuverlässig. In Wirklichkeit können die Daten jedoch Verzerrungen und Verlusten ausgesetzt sein, daher werden verschiedene Methoden zur Überprüfung und Wiederherstellung von Daten verwendet, um eine zuverlässige Übertragung über das Netzwerk zu gewährleisten.

Daher ist Bitcode das wichtigste Werkzeug für die Darstellung und Übertragung von Daten über ein Netzwerk. Es ermöglicht Computern und Geräten, Informationen auszutauschen, verschiedene Operationen durchzuführen und eine zuverlässige Kommunikation im Netzwerk zu ermöglichen.